Common Causes
— Clogged or dirty filter reducing water flow and cleaning effectiveness
— Blocked spray arm holes preventing water from reaching all dishes
— Low water temperature affecting detergent activation and cleaning power
— Overloaded or incorrectly loaded dish rack blocking spray coverage
— Worn or failing wash pump not generating sufficient water pressure

When Professional Diagnosis Is Recommended
If cleaning the filter and checking the spray arms does not restore normal wash performance, professional inspection is recommended. Pump and motor components require proper testing equipment to diagnose accurately without causing additional damage.
